If you are interested and have the following attributes, please apply online at Summary/Objective The Equipment Maintenance Coordinator position is responsible for planning, coordinating and directing the operations of all equipment for effective maintenance and repair. This position acts as a technical advisor on all equipment issues and assists the management team with equipment budgets and potential equipment purchases. This position also ensures adequate equipment is available to employees - both quantity and quality. Perform skilled duties that may include, minor electrical and other recognized crafts for the purpose of maintaining and repairing equipment. Maintenance of all property and building maintenance to ensure both are maintained. Essential Functions Maintain, repair, and inventory equipment used by Sign Setters and Flaggers. This includes • All roll-up signs • Stop/Slow paddles • Lights/Batteries • Arrowboard/Arrowboard Trailers • Barrels/Cones/Candlesticks • Temporary Sign Supports • Jersey Barrier Sign Stands • Windmaster Stands/Stationery Stands • Fill Sand Bags •Deliver signs and equipment to various jobsites. •Keep shop organized, clean and secure. •Maintain proper tools and supplies in order to make repairs to flagging equipment. •Ensure office has adequate lighting, all plumbing fixtures are leak-free, windows, doors and screens are in good, working condition. •Facilitate or assist in any special projects that may change the office or grounds. Suggest methods or plans for approval. •Assist Sign Setters with equipment check-out or returns and maintain inventory control records. •Responsible to identify rented equipment that must be returned. •Identify roll-up signs that require industrial sewing repairs. Remove sign from frame for delivery to outside repair. •Repair signs that the script or image are fading away (must be painted black), back to original condition. •Maintain reflective collars on cones/candlesticks and clean cones/candlesticks that have excess dirt or tar from work zones. •Maintenance of the property grounds. •Responsible for all building maintenance. •Other duties may be assigned. Required Education and Experience • Must be 18 years of age or older. • Successful completion of drug test. • Successful completion of background screen. • Must meet the company guidelines for work-related driving. • Must have a High School diploma with a minimum five (5) years Equipment Maintenance experience. License and Certification • CPR/First Aid Certification required or obtained within thirty (30) days from hire date. • Possess a valid state driver’s license, in the state you reside in. • Must have a clean Motor Vehicle Record (MVR)
